Rancher2.0 业务逻辑及概念       摘要:本文档重点介绍Rancher2.0 业务逻辑及K8s(Kubernetes)相关概念,为方便理解,文档根据Rancher UI界面从Global 、Cluster、Project 分层次介绍在不同业务层次的相关业务逻辑,资源操作与重要概念。Global层如图所示,在global层可操
转载 10月前
113阅读
0.接口简述Stream 的特性可以归纳为:不是数据结构它没有内部存储,它只是用操作管道从 source(数据结构、数组、generator function、IO channel)抓取数据。它也绝不修改自己所封装的底层数据结构的数据。例如 Stream 的 filter 操作会产生一个不包含被过滤元素的新 Stream,而不是从 source 删除那些元素。所有 Stream 的操作必须以 la
转载 2024-10-16 09:35:38
49阅读
最近在做一个资源共享的项目中,采用了Struts2.1.8+Spring2.5.6+hibernate3.32的框架整合方式进行开发。在文件上传这块,因为需要实现文件上传时显示进度条的功能,所以尝试了一下。怕以后忘记,先贴出来分享下。 要在上传文件时能显示进度条,首先需要实时的获知web服务端接收了多少字节,以及文件总大小,这里我们在页面上使用AJAX技术每一秒向服务器发送一次请求来获得
一、spring task1. XML配置方式(1)配置定时器 :<task:scheduler id="scheduler" pool-size="5" /> (2)配置定时任务: <task:scheduled-tasks scheduler="scheduler" > <task:scheduled ref="profitScheduler" me
学习集成hystrix时候发现配置文件里的超时时间把我给弄晕了,老办法google之,找Issue:https://github.com/spring-cloud/spring-cloud-netflix/issues/1324找到能解决这个问题的文章,最好还是得找到原理图学习。如果是zuul(网关)的超时时间需要设置zuul、hystrix、ribbon等三部分:#zuul超时设置#默认1000
转载 2024-02-22 18:06:50
296阅读
一、主机配置1、配置要求参考节点要求2、主机名配置因为K8S的规定,主机名只支持包含 - 和 .(中横线和点)两种特殊符号,并且主机名不能出现重复。3、Hosts配置每台主机的hosts(/etc/hosts),添加host_ip $hostname到/etc/hosts文件中。4、CentOS关闭selinuxsudo sed -i 's/SELINUX=enfor
转载 2024-02-22 12:23:49
411阅读
大多数的Nginx安装指南告诉你如下基础知识——通过apt-get安装,修改这里或那里的几行配置,好了,你已经有了一个Web服务器了。而且,在大多数情况下,一个常规安装的nginx对你的网站来说已经能很好地工作了。然而,如果你真的想挤压出Nginx的性能,你必须更深入一些。在本指南中,我将解释Nginx的那些设置可以微调,以优化处理大量客户端时的性能。需要注意一点,这不是一个全面的微调指南。这是一
  编程式事务管理使用TransactionTemplate或者直接使用底层的PlatformTransactionManager。对于编程式事务管理,spring推荐使用TransactionTemplate事务超时      所谓事务超时,指一个事务所允许执行的最长时间,如果超过该时间限制但事务还没有完成,则自动回滚事务。在 TransactionDefiniti
转载 2023-11-15 18:42:33
327阅读
客户端连接源码分析ZKClient 客户端,Curator 客户端 先下结论:Client 要创建一个连接,其首先会在本地创建一个 ZooKeeper 对象,用于表示其所连接上的 Server。 连接成功后,该连接的各种临时性数据会被初始化到 zk 对象中。 连接关闭后,这个代表 Server 的 zk 对象会被删除。我们知道常用的ZK客户端技术有ZKClient 客户端,Curator 客户端,
1、启动单台zookeeper创建conf/zoo.cfg文件,并如下配置//单位ms, zookeeper的心跳时间,session timeout这个时间的的2倍 tickTime=2000 //持久化快照文件的保存目录,如果transaction log保存的目录没有指定,也会保存在这个目录中 dataDir=/var/lib/zookeeper //客户端连接端口 clientPort
节点软硬件要求节点硬件要求请参考:https://docs.rancher.cn/docs/rancher2/installation_new/requirements/_index/节点基础环境配置请参考 基础环境配置同步镜像如果你是在离线环境安装,请先访问rancher 离线安装镜像同步,按照方法同步所有镜像到离线私有镜像仓库。如果主机能够直接拉取镜像,则跳过此步骤。创建 rke 配置文件使用
转载 3月前
390阅读
# RedissonClient 超时时间配置 在实际的开发中,我们经常会使用 Redis 作为缓存或分布式锁的存储介质。而在 Java 开发中,可以使用 Redisson 这个 Redis 的 Java 客户端来操作 Redis 数据库。 Redisson 提供了一种简单且强大的方法来与 Redis 进行交互,其中包括了一系列可以方便我们使用的功能。本文将介绍如何配置 RedissonCli
原创 2024-05-20 05:05:38
246阅读
# 配置MySQL超时时间 ## 概述 在开发过程中,我们经常会遇到需要配置MySQL超时时间的情况。MySQL超时时间是指当连接到MySQL服务器后,如果一段时间内没有进行任何操作,服务器会自动关闭连接的时间。本文将详细介绍如何配置MySQL超时时间。 ## 流程 ```mermaid flowchart TD A[连接到MySQL服务器] --> B[查询当前超时时间]
原创 2023-11-29 07:51:33
81阅读
        在工作中,出现使用Druid链接Postgresql数据库,当第一次动态链接数据库源或者连过长时间不使用数据库时,出现链接过程缓慢,甚至hold的情况,链接时间以分计算,导致前端接口响应缓慢,影响用户操作问题。        经过日志的排查,发现是在DruidDataSource对象链接数据源过程中卡主
此文章不论述dubbo,zookeeper 的作用,相关问题请谷歌或百度,都有详细回答。一、首先是使用的开发环境,插件版本等:系统:windows7开发工具:Eclipse-4.5.0,此版本支持JDK1.7。最新版本的Eclipse已不支持1.7其他管理工具等:Maven-3.1.1,dubbo-2.5.8,zookeeper-3.4.9二、搭建步骤:1)下载 zookeeper 解压包,con
转载 2024-04-28 21:04:15
422阅读
**MySQL配置超时时间** 作为一名经验丰富的开发者,我将向你介绍如何配置MySQL的超时时间。MySQL的超时时间是指当连接到MySQL服务器后,如果一段时间内没有活动,服务器会自动断开连接以释放资源。配置超时时间可以提高系统的性能和安全性。 以下是配置MySQL超时时间的步骤: 步骤 | 描述 --- | --- Step 1 | 连接到MySQL服务器 Step 2 | 检查当前的
原创 2023-09-30 13:23:13
509阅读
     本篇文章记录小Z在学习使用JAVA Mail API发送邮件的代码过程      首先,小Z的需求是希望发送一封邮件到自己的QQ邮箱中,当然还是通俗易懂的Hello World。      需要开启QQ邮箱中的设置,开启POP3/SMTP服务      根据要求发送短信到腾讯科技,配置邮件客户端,随后您会获得授权码,该授权码用于之后的代
什么是延迟加载:  resultMap中的association和collection标签具有延迟加载的功能。延迟加载就是在我们关联查询的时候李勇延迟加载,先加载主信息,使用到关联信息的时候再去加载关联信息。通俗一点讲就是一个类里面引用另一个类,当使用到另一个类的时候另一个类再去赋值。设置延迟加载:  在myabtis的全局配置文件里面配置全局加载 lazyLoadingEnabled、aggre
docker的概述docker出现的背景一款产品的上线往往会经过开发,上线等阶段,而开发往往在本地,上线则需要将产品跑在另一台机器上,而这样往往会出现一个问题:在自己本地跑的时候没有问题,但是上线跑就不行了。造成这个原因往往可能是因为开发和生产环境不同导致的,因此,为了解决这个问题,docker应运而生。什么是docker官方解释:Docker is an open platform for de
timeout 1 本想通过$httpProvider的defaults属性配置timeout时间, defaults中没有这个属性. https://docs.angularjs.org/api/ng/provider/$httpProvider defaults timeout 2 在拦截器中为
转载 2018-04-01 11:30:00
414阅读
2评论
  • 1
  • 2
  • 3
  • 4
  • 5